#5b3629 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b3629 is composed of 35.7% red, 21.2%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.7% magenta, 54.9%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 15.6 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 25.9%. #5b3629 color hex could be obtained by blending #b66c52 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#5b3629 color description : Very dark desaturated orange.

#5b3629 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5b3629 has RGB values of R:91, G:54,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.55,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 5977641.

Shades and Tints of #5b3629

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0604 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5b3629

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#47403d is the less saturated color, while #842300 is the most saturated one.
